The Fly-In Experience: Hornepayne’s Remote Wilderness

Hornepayne, Ontario, is a small, remote town in northern Ontario that offers some of the most pristine fishing in the world. From Hornepayne, a small float plane transports the group of fisherman and all of their fishing gear into the untouched wilderness, where the lakes are teeming with northern pike, walleye, and perch.

Because no roads, trails, or rivers allow access to these fishing grounds—everything has to be flown in, so this isn’t your typical drive-to-the-lake weekend getaway. It’s a true escape, where nature takes center stage, and the distractions of everyday life are left far behind.
